Sleep and Weight Loss – Losing Sleep But Not Weight

Published on January 22, 2010 by Technology Slice

Losing weight while you sleep, sounds like the best method for loosing weight but most people are not taking advantage of it and sacrificing potential weight loss. But before you go off to sleep away the day having too much sleep can have the opposite affect on your weight loss goals. Recent studies have shown that people who sleep six hours or less a night and more than nine hours are more likely to be obese or overweight.
